About The Position

Bohler’s Miami, FL office is seeking a Senior Survey Technician to join our growing land surveying team supporting projects throughout the Miami area. In this role, you’ll prepare ALTA/ACSM Land Title Surveys, Boundary & Topographic Surveys, and As-Built drawings with minimal supervision. You’ll evaluate field work for accuracy, compile deeds and base sketches, and ensure all survey data is complete, correct, and ready for engineering design. You’ll also help guide junior technicians, sharing your expertise and upholding Bohler’s standards of precision and quality.

Responsibilities

  • Prepare detailed ALTA/ACSM, boundary, topographic, and as-built surveys using AutoCAD Civil 3D
  • Evaluate and process field crew data to ensure accuracy and completeness
  • Generate surfaces using 3D polylines and points for integration into engineering design
  • Perform deed plotting, base map compilation, and data verification
  • Conduct construction computations and provide technical oversight to junior staff when needed
  • Deliver and share data seamlessly between field and office teams
  • Identify and communicate technical issues or data discrepancies to leadership
  • Contribute to quality assurance through careful checking and adherence to standards
